Description
Term
% Correct
Runs down midline of abdomen, formed by fusion of the aponeuroses of abdominal muscles
linea alba
48.8%
Separates frontal and parietal bones
coronal suture
45.6%
Nerve roots at inferior end of spinal chord
cauda equina
44.8%
Sheath that contains the rectus abdominis within it
rectus sheath
40.8%
Ligament that connects spinous processes and becomes nuchal ligament
supraspinous ligament
40%
Fossa of back of knee
popliteal fossa
40%
Ligament that connects laminae of vertebrae
ligamentum flavum
39.2%
Foramen formed by the ischium and pubis bones
obturator foramen
37.6%
The bone located at the caudal portion of the roof of the mouth
palatine bone
36.8%
Pleural recess between the costal pleura and diaphragmatic pleura
costodiaphragmatic recess
36%
Point where the two parietal bones come together with the occipital bone
lambda
35.2%
Junction between parietal bone, temporal bone, sphenoid bone, and fronal bone
pterion
34.4%
Forearm muscle that flexes the fingers
flexor digitorum superficialis
34.4%
Lateral branch of sciatic nerve
common fibular nerve
34.4%
The inferior end of the spinal chord
conus medullaris
33.6%
Strand of fibrous tissue attaching end of spinal chord to the coccyx
filum terminale
33.6%
Connects the liver to the abdominal wall
falciform ligament
33.6%
Term for the urethra as it goes through the prostate
prostatic urethra
33.6%
Separates temporal and parietal bones
squamous suture
33.6%
Continuation of anterior tibial artery over dorsum of foot
dorsalis pedis artery
33.6%
Space between the dura matter and the edge of the spinal column
epidural space
32%
Branches off subclavian artery and suplies the anterior intercostal arteries
internal thoracic artery
32%
Peritoneum that connects sigmoid colon to abdominal wall
sigmoid mesocolon
32%
Peritoneum that connects transverse colon to abdominal wall
transverse mesocolon
31.2%
Fibrous sheet that connects radius and ulna
interosseous membrane
31.2%
Become the femoral vessels inferior to the inguinal ligament
external iliac vessels
31.2%
Drains posterior intercostal veins and empties into superior vena cava
azygos vein
30.4%
Middle portion of oviduct
ampulla
30.4%
Part of ethmoid bone that gives attachment to falx cerebri
crista galli
30.4%
Ligament that suspends spinal chord in dural sac
denticulate ligament
29.6%
